"Red" Henderson, 82, of Route 3, died Wednesday (Aug. 24, 1994) at his home. He was the widower of Clair Virginia Henderson. He was born Oct. 26, 1911, in Nelson County, a son of Charlie Fritz and Dora Cook Henderson. He retired from Du Pont in 1972 following 42 years of service and was a veteran of World War II. He was preceded in death by a brother, Grover E. Henderson; and three sisters, Ollie Henderson Critzer, Anny Pearle Moneymake, and Effie Elizabeth Henderson. He is survived by two brothers, Louis L. Henderson of Harriston and Oliver A. Henderson of Waynesboro; two sisters, Erssie Wade of Fishers- ville and Lena Henderson of Afton; and numerous nieces and nephews. A service will be conducted at 2 p.m. today at the chapel of McDow Funeral Home by the Rev. Wll Heyward. Interment will follow in Augusta Memorial Park. Pallbearers will be James Higgs, Kenny Critzer Jr., Steve Wright, Ronnie Via, Dennis Cook and David Critzer. The family will receive friends, from 7 to 8 p.m. today at the funeral home.
